Оставьте заявку, мы подберем для вас подходящего специалиста за 48 часов!
Премия рунета

Ксушниджон К. IOS разработчик, Middle

ID 5289
КК
Ксушниджон К.
Мужчина
Узбекистан, Ташкент, UTC+5
Ставка
2,125 Р/час
НДС не облагается
Специалист доступен с 29 марта 2024 г.

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ны.

Подробнее
О специалисте
Специализация
IOS разработчик
Грейд
Middle
Навыки
Swift
Objective-C
Kotlin
Java
C++
Combine
Alamofire
GCD
Google Maps
Yandex Maps
Google
ADDS
SnapKit
UI
Unit testing
Autolayout
Moya
Storyboards
Xib
TestFlight
Firebase SDK
Firebase Crashlytics
Firebase
Clean Architecture
MVC
MVVM
SOLID
Redux
Coordinator
XCoordinator
REST
JSON
JWT
XML
HTML
CSS
Jira
Trello
Git
GitHub
GitLab
Знание языков
Английский — B2
Проекты   (2 года 11 месяцев)
itechart
Роль
iOS Engineer
Обязанности
Построил проект полностью с помощью SwiftUI, добившись идеально работающей навигации Создан SPM для добавления задач в Jira и Trello, используя Atlassian API Создана синхронизация данных потока между хостом и пользователем (таймеры, задачи) Взял на себя одну из главных ролей архитектора, используя Combine + MVVM, с различными паттернема проектирования Технологии/языки/инструменты: SwiftUI, Combine, Firebase, Firebase Firestore, MVVM, Router, Clean architecture, SOLID, CI, CD, Unit Tests (XCTest), SPM, SwiftLint
Период работы
Январь 2022 - Декабрь 2022  (1 год)
MySkin - Fain
Роль
iOS Software Engineer
Обязанности
Редизайн и рефакторинг исходного кода для обеспечения лучшей масштабируемости ремонтопригодность и читаемость кода Создали многократно используемый код и библиотеки для будущего использования Использовали подход Xcode Scheme, чтобы избежать дублирования кода для проектов Skin Улучшена библиотека Bluetooth-соединения для более быстрого соединения Технологии/языки/инструменты: Swift, Objective C, RxSwift, RxCacao, MVVM-C, Clean architecture, SOLID, Realm, REST, JSON, JWT, Multithreading, CocoaPods, Git, GitHub
Период работы
Ноябрь 2021 - Январь 2022  (3 месяца)
DermoBella Skin/Hair 2
Роль
iOS Software Engineer
Обязанности
Разработка пользовательского интерфейса приложения для обеспечения лучшего внешнего вида и ощущения на различных устройствах Использовал подход Xcode Scheme, чтобы избежать дублирования кода для проектов Hair/Skin Реализовал такие функции, как аутентификация, CRM, облачный анализ изображений и страница результатов анализа Создание многократно используемого кода и библиотек для будущего использования Технологии/языки/инструменты: Swift, Objective C, RxSwift, RxCacao, MVVM-C, Clean architecture, SOLID, Realm, REST, JSON, JWT, Multithreading, CocoaPods, Git, GitHub
Период работы
Июнь 2021 - Январь 2022  (8 месяцев)
Формат работы
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Нет

Похожие специалисты

FoodTech • GameDev • Travel, Hospitality & Restaurant business
АК
Александр К.
Москва
IOS разработчик
Middle+
3,000 Р/час
Bitbucket
Clean Architecture
CocoaPods
Combine
CoreData
Data
DRY
GCD
GitHub
GitLab
+61

НАВЫКИ И КОМПЕТЕНЦИИ Swift, SwiftUI, UIKit , RxSwift, Combine, Data Persistence, SnapKit, NSAutoLayout, CoreData, CoreAnimation, CocoaPods, MVP+C, MVC, MVVM, MVVM+C, VIPER, GCD, Xcode Debugger, SOLID, DRY, KISS, YAGNI, Clean Architecture, GitHub, Gitlab, Bitbucket, знание классических алгоритмов, Unit Testing, Objective-C ОПЫТ Проект: ОneTwoTrip. (Июль 2022 - по настоящее время) 1 год 6 мес Описание: Мобильное приложение для путешественников всех категорий Роль: iOS developer Команда: 3 iOS, 3 Android, 1 QA, 2 Analyst, 1 Designer, 1 PM Стек: SwiftUI + UIKit, SwiftUIBackports, BottomSheet, Yandex Maps Mobile, MVVM, Combine, Git, Jira, HIG, Async/Await, знание классических алгоритмов, Swift Package Manager Задачи: Общение с руководителем проекта, бэкендом, командой android-разработчиков; Изменение, доработка и создание UI согласно предоставленными макетами Figma; Перевод проекта на актуальный стек технологий; Внедрил чат-поддержку в проект с помощью UseDesk; Рефакторинг, исправление ошибок и доработка проекта; Разработал экран фильтрации, экран профиля, Создавал сложные кастомные элементы UI (например: календарь), с последующей интеграцией в разные части проекта; Осуществлял связь функционала между SwiftUI и UIKit; Добавил функционал Push-уведомлений; Занимался выгрузкой приложения в TestFlight и добавлением команд тестировщиков в appStoreConnect Проект: Alfa Ecosystem (январь 2021 — июнь 2022) 1 год 6 мес Описание: Приложение для доставки продуктов Роль: iOS developer Команда: (продуктовая) 4 - iOS developer, 4 - android developer, 5 - back, 5 - тестировщиков, 1 - системный аналитик, 2 - бизнес аналитика, 1- дизайнер, 2 - Деливери менеджера, 1- продакт Стек: Swift, UIKit, Combine, MVVM+C, SnapKit, Cocoa Pods, Fork, UserDefaults, CoreData, JSON, RESTful API. Личные результаты: Реализовал интерфейс главного экрана приложения при переходе на новый дизайн Принимал участие в создании экранов карточки продукта и корзины Реализовал логику добавления това

Подробнее

Недавно просмотренные специалисты